Process Parameters for Solid Investment Moulding of Magnesium Alloys

Solid investment moulding is a versatile process for preparation of magnesium prototypes. The casting of complex shapes with thin walls and few defects requires a good knowledge of process parameters. In this work, experiments have been performed on pure magnesium and AZ91 alloys to determine the influence of various parameters such as mould temperature, vacuum assistance, and alloys composition on filling capacity, flowability, microstructure of castings and surface finish.
